Are you a graduate of the MHPC Occupational Therapy Assistant (OTA) Program looking to become a licensed Occupational Therapist (OT)? Union Adventist University (UAU) offers an OTA-to-OT Bridge Program designed to help certified OTAs seamlessly transition into a Master’s-level Occupational Therapy program.
Located in Lincoln, Nebraska, Union Adventist University provides a supportive and mission-driven environment where students can grow professionally and spiritually.
Program Highlights:
- Tailored for OTA Graduates: Specifically designed for practicing OTAs, with advanced standing options for eligible MHPC graduates.
- Flexible Format: Hybrid courses blend online instruction with hands-on learning experiences to support working professionals.
- Supportive Faculty: Learn from experienced educators who are committed to your success in the field of occupational therapy.
- Faith-Based Learning: Develop your clinical skills while grounded in values of compassion, service, and integrity.

Admissions Requirements:
- Graduation from an accredited OTA program (MHPC OTA graduates receive special consideration)
- Current NBCOT certification or eligibility
- Prerequisite coursework completed with a minimum GPA (see website for details)
- Letters of recommendation, personal statement, and interview
